Good news for cyclists using the railway station
Written by HFM on 23rd July 2019
There’s good news for anyone who cycles to catch a train in Market
Harborough – a hundred extra bike spaces have been promised there.
It follows a recent visit to the new look station by Rail Minister,
Andrew Jones.
Harborough’s MP, Neil O’Brien, requested the extra capacity because an
increasing number of residents are now choosing to cycle to begin their
daily commute.
He says not only is this good for people’s health, but fewer cars making
the journey should hopefully have a positive impact on congestion and
air quality, too.
